win10下快速部署docker
首先你要注意的是你的windows系统是什么系统,如果是win7,win8则我给你推荐一个网站。
上面有详细教程[docker中文社区](http://www.docker.org.cn/book/install/install-docker-win7-win8-requirements-38.html)
其在docker部署上的要求就是要有Hyper-V,和在Mac上部署的原理类似。
由于docker的容器用的是lxc则需要用win10自带得虚拟机去创建一个linux虚拟机。
首先先打开win10的Hyper-V,控制面板 -> 程序 -> 启用或关闭Windows功能 -> 选中Hyper-V
文章图片
设置完成后重启
然后在[docker官网上下载](https://download.docker.com/win/stable/InstallDocker.msi)
傻瓜式安装完成
【win10下快速部署docker】然后就可以在CMD中输入docker -version查看docker得版本
接下来,需要下载ToolBox
安装ToolBox记得不需要安装VitrualBox
接下来在cmd中输入
docker-machine create –driver hyperv default
新建一个虚拟机,应为ToolBox中是默认用VitrualBox来建得,如果直接点击Docker Quickstart Terminal则会提示新建失败
如果连接失败注意此处,需要打开Hyper-V管理器->虚拟交换机管理器->将连接得网络改为外部网络。点击应用。参照官网
这样就可以在win10上运行docker容器。
推荐阅读
- 开学第一天(下)
- 【故障公告】周五下午的一次突发故障
- 生活随笔|好天气下的意外之喜
- MongoDB,Wondows下免安装版|MongoDB,Wondows下免安装版 (简化版操作)
- 汇讲-勇于突破
- Android中的AES加密-下
- 说的真好
- 放下心中的偶像包袱吧
- Linux下面如何查看tomcat已经使用多少线程
- 【1057快报】深入机关,走下田间,交通普法,共创文明